Daniel Booker Marsh, Jr.
November 24, 1932 – September 4, 2014

Funeral services for Daniel Booker Marsh, Jr., 81, of Livingston, Texas, will be held at 10:00 A.M. on Tuesday, September 9, 2014 at Central Baptist Church in Livingston, Texas with Pastor Mike Meadows officiating. Interment will be held at 2:00 P.M. at San Jacinto Memorial Park Cemetery in Houston, Texas. Visitation will begin at 5:00 P.M. on Monday, September 8, 2014 at Cochran Funeral Home Funeral in Livingston, Texas.

Daniel was born on November 24, 1932 in Troy, Kansas to parents, Daniel Booker Marsh, Sr. and Katie (Hartmann) Marsh and passed away on September 4, 2014 at his home in Livingston, Texas. Dan proudly served his country in both the Army and the National Guard. He had many passions in life, including his love for John Deere tractors, it didn’t matter the size, large or small. Dan was a licensed ordained minister and also served as Deacon at Central Baptist Church. He enjoyed bailing hay, listening to Southern Gospel Music, and loved the time he spent with his family, grandchildren and great-grandchildren. If there was one word to describe Daniel Marsh, that word would be “Faithful.”

Dan is preceded in death by his parents, Daniel and Katie Marsh; brothers, Warren Marsh, Cliff Marsh, and Bob Marsh; and beloved wife, Ann Marsh.

He is survived by his sons, Daniel Marsh III and fiancé, Gwen, Tim Marsh and wife, Christie, and Allen Thomason; daughter, Cheryl Fuller and husband, Louis; grandchildren, Skye Dawn Marsh, Kenny Gurley and wife, Jeanette, Jonathan Gurley and wife, Mary, April Spell and husband, Jay, Robert Fuller, and Leah Ritchie and husband, Jim; great-grandchildren, Rush Hudson Gurley, Ashtyn Gurley, Andrew Gurley, Jacob Dike, Lilly Spell, London Spell, Emma Ritchey, and Tara Ritchey; brothers, Roger Marsh and wife, Mabel, Chester Marsh and wife, Naomi, Walter Marsh and wife, Jean; sister, Margaret Benford and husband, Harold; along with other numerous family and friends.

Dan will be escorted to his final resting place by pallbearers, Kenneth Gurley, Jonathan Gurley, Robert Fuller, Jay Spell, Jim Marsh, and Jim Chaplin.
